The concept of cloud infrastructure has undergone significant transformations since its inception. From its humble beginnings to the current state of affairs, the evolution of cloud infrastructure has been marked by numerous innovations, advancements, and paradigm shifts. In this article, we will delve into the past, present, and future of cloud infrastructure, exploring the key milestones, trends, and developments that have shaped the industry.
History of Cloud Infrastructure
The history of cloud infrastructure dates back to the 1960s, when the concept of time-sharing and virtualization first emerged. However, it wasn't until the 1990s and early 2000s that the modern cloud infrastructure began to take shape. During this period, companies like Salesforce and Amazon Web Services (AWS) pioneered the concept of cloud computing, offering scalable and on-demand computing resources over the internet. The launch of AWS in 2006 marked a significant turning point in the evolution of cloud infrastructure, as it provided a platform for businesses to deploy and manage applications without the need for expensive hardware and software investments.
Present State of Cloud Infrastructure
Today, cloud infrastructure is a ubiquitous and essential component of modern computing. The present state of cloud infrastructure is characterized by a high degree of scalability, flexibility, and cost-effectiveness. Cloud providers like AWS, Microsoft Azure, Google Cloud Platform (GCP), and IBM Cloud offer a wide range of services, including infrastructure as a service (IaaS), platform as a service (PaaS), and software as a service (SaaS). These services enable businesses to deploy and manage applications, store and process data, and develop new software and services without the need for significant upfront investments. The present state of cloud infrastructure is also marked by a growing trend towards hybrid and multi-cloud deployments, as businesses seek to optimize their IT resources and minimize vendor lock-in.
Future of Cloud Infrastructure
The future of cloud infrastructure is expected to be shaped by several key trends and developments. One of the most significant trends is the growing adoption of edge computing, which involves processing data closer to the source of generation to reduce latency and improve real-time decision-making. Another trend is the increasing use of artificial intelligence (AI) and machine learning (ML) in cloud infrastructure, which is expected to enable greater automation, optimization, and innovation in cloud-based applications and services. The future of cloud infrastructure is also expected to be marked by a greater emphasis on security, compliance, and sustainability, as businesses and organizations seek to mitigate the risks associated with cloud computing and minimize their environmental footprint.
Key Drivers of Cloud Infrastructure Evolution
Several key drivers have contributed to the evolution of cloud infrastructure over the years. One of the most significant drivers is the growing demand for scalability and flexibility in IT resources. As businesses and organizations have sought to respond to changing market conditions and customer needs, they have required more agile and adaptable IT infrastructure, which cloud computing has been able to provide. Another key driver is the need for cost savings and reduced capital expenditures. Cloud computing has enabled businesses to reduce their IT costs and minimize their upfront investments, which has been a major factor in its adoption. The evolution of cloud infrastructure has also been driven by advances in technology, including the development of virtualization, containerization, and serverless computing.
Impact of Cloud Infrastructure on Business and Society
The evolution of cloud infrastructure has had a profound impact on business and society. Cloud computing has enabled businesses to innovate and respond to changing market conditions more quickly and effectively, which has driven growth, productivity, and competitiveness. Cloud infrastructure has also enabled the development of new business models and industries, such as the sharing economy and online marketplaces. In addition, cloud computing has had a significant impact on society, enabling greater access to information, education, and healthcare, and facilitating the development of new technologies and innovations, such as AI, ML, and the Internet of Things (IoT).
Challenges and Opportunities in Cloud Infrastructure
Despite the many benefits and advantages of cloud infrastructure, there are also several challenges and opportunities that need to be addressed. One of the most significant challenges is security, as cloud computing introduces new risks and vulnerabilities that need to be mitigated. Another challenge is compliance, as businesses and organizations need to ensure that their cloud-based applications and services meet relevant regulatory and industry standards. The evolution of cloud infrastructure also presents several opportunities, including the development of new technologies and innovations, such as quantum computing and blockchain, and the creation of new business models and industries, such as cloud-based services and cloud-native applications.
Conclusion
In conclusion, the evolution of cloud infrastructure has been a long and winding road, marked by numerous innovations, advancements, and paradigm shifts. From its humble beginnings to the current state of affairs, cloud infrastructure has come a long way, and its impact on business and society has been profound. As we look to the future, it is clear that cloud infrastructure will continue to play a critical role in shaping the world of IT and beyond. By understanding the past, present, and future of cloud infrastructure, businesses and organizations can better navigate the complexities of cloud computing and capitalize on the many benefits and opportunities that it has to offer.